ORAL SIDE EFFECTS OF SYSTEMIC TREATMENT IN WOMEN WITH BREAST CANCER VISITING REHMAN MEDICAL INSTITUTE PESHAWAR: A CROSS-SECTIONAL SURVEY

Objective:
To characterize the oral health in breast cancer survivors treated in the Rehman Medical Institute, Peshawar.
Materials and Methods:
This was a cross-sectional study conducted at the Rehman Medical Institute Peshawar between Jan 2017 and June 2018 of women diagnosed with Breast Cancer who received care. Forty three patients were selected in both breast cancer groups as well as in control group. Initially diagnosed patients of breast cancer, followed by surgical therapy and additional radio and chemotherapy were included in this study. Whereas female patients who received (supplementary/solely) endocrine or immunological therapy were excluded from this study, similarly were the women with severe chronic diseases such as chronic heart disease,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ease and other cancers. Statistical analysis analysis were performed with the SPSS , Version 22.0.
Results:
Unfavorable oral health status of women who received breast cancer treatment compared to the oral health status of the control group has been shown in this study.
Conclusion:
Results indicate a need for more education about the potential oral effects of breast cancer therapies and about providing the best possible care for patients undergoing breast cancer treatment.
